Types of Child Care Alternatives

There are many forms of childcare solutions, each catering to various age ranges and schedules. Probably the most common kinds of childcare choices include:

  1. Daycare facilities: Daycare facilities are services that offer maintain kiddies of numerous centuries, usually from infancy to preschool. These centers tend to be licensed and regulated because of the state, ensuring that they meet particular requirements for safety, hygiene, and staff skills. Daycare centers provide organized activities, meals, and supervision for the kids in a group setting.

  1. Family Child Care Homes: Family childcare houses tend to be tiny, home-based childcare services run by an individual caregiver or a little selection of caregivers. These providers offer a more tailored and family-like environment for the kids, with less kids in treatment in comparison to daycare facilities. Family child care domiciles may offer versatile hours and prices, making all of them a well known choice for parents who need much more personalized maintain their child.

  1. Preschools: Preschools tend to be educational organizations that provide early youth training for the kids usually between the many years of 2 to five years old. These programs target organizing children for preschool by introducing all of them to fundamental scholastic principles, personal skills, and emotional development. Preschools usually are powered by a school-year schedule and provide part-time or full time alternatives for parents.

  1. Before and After class Programs: pre and post school programs are made to supply maintain school-aged kids throughout the hours pre and post the standard school day. These programs offer multiple activities, homework help, and direction for kids while parents have reached work. Before and after school programs are usually made available from schools, community facilities, or private organizations.

  1. Nanny or Au set: Nannies and au sets tend to be people who provide in-home child care solutions for families. Nannies in many cases are experienced professionals who offer full time maintain children into the family's residence, while au sets tend to be teenagers from foreign nations which stay utilizing the family members and provide cultural exchange alongside childcare. Nannies and au sets provide personalized attention and versatility in scheduling for parents.

Things to consider When Selecting Child Care

When choosing child care in your area, it's important to give consideration to a few aspects to ensure you see an excellent and appropriate choice for your son or daughter. Some of the key factors to think about consist of:

  1. Licensing and Accreditation: it is vital to select a licensed and approved child care supplier, because means that the facility meets particular standards for security, cleanliness, staff skills, and program quality. Certification and accreditation illustrate the provider has encountered a rigorous assessment process and is focused on maintaining large criteria of attention.

  1. Team Qualifications and Training: The skills and instruction for the staff in the childcare facility are crucial in providing high quality take care of kids. Try to find providers who possess trained and experienced caregivers, along with staff who are certified in CPR and first aid. Staff-to-child ratios are also essential, as they determine the level of attention and guidance that every child obtains.

  1. Curriculum and plan strategies: think about the curriculum and program tasks offered Daycares By Category the child care supplier, because they perform an important part into the development and understanding of your youngster. Seek programs that offer age-appropriate activities, educational opportunities, and possibilities for socialization. A well-rounded curriculum which includes play, art, songs, and outdoor time can play a role in your son or daughter's overall development.

  1. Safety and health Policies: make sure that the kid treatment provider features rigid safety and health guidelines set up to protect the well-being of your kid. Look for services that follow correct hygiene practices, have safe entry and exit treatments, and continue maintaining on a clean and child-friendly environment. Inquire about disaster processes, disease policies, and just how the supplier manages accidents or situations.

  1. Parent Involvement and Communication: Pick a kid treatment supplier that motivates moms and dad involvement and maintains available communication with households. Search for providers offering possibilities for moms and dads to participate in tasks, events, and conferences, in addition to regular changes on your own child's development and well-being. A good relationship between moms and dads and caregivers can lead to a confident and supporting childcare knowledge.

Finding Child Care Towards You

Now you have considered the facets to consider in a young child attention provider, it's time to start the look for high quality child care near you. Below are a few tips and resources to assist you find a very good choice for your son or daughter:

  1. Ask for Recommendations: begin by requesting recommendations from family, friends, neighbors, and coworkers who've children in child care. Individual recommendations could be a valuable way to obtain information on quality child care providers in your area. Enquire about their particular experiences, whatever they fancy about the provider, and any concerns they could have.

  1. Analysis on line: Use online resources such as childcare directories, parenting internet sites, and social media marketing teams to analyze child care providers in your town. Seek out providers with reviews that are positive, high score, and detailed information about their particular programs and solutions. Numerous providers have web pages or social networking pages where you can find out about their facilities and staff.

  1. See Child Care facilities: Schedule visits to potential childcare centers to visit the services, meet with the staff, and take notice of the system doing his thing. Focus on the hygiene, security precautions, and total environment of the center. Ask questions about the curriculum, staff qualifications, day-to-day routines, and guidelines for a sense of the way the center operates.

  1. Interview Caregivers: When meeting with possible caregivers, ask about their particular knowledge, instruction, and method of child care. Inquire about their viewpoint on discipline, communication with parents, and how they handle emergencies or challenging behaviors. Trust your instincts and select caregivers who are hot, attentive, and tuned in to your child's requirements.

  1. Check recommendations: demand recommendations from child care provider and contact all of them to inquire about their particular experiences utilizing the provider. Enquire about the standard of treatment, communication with moms and dads, staff interactions, and any problems they might have had. Recommendations provides valuable insights to the supplier's reputation and history.

  1. Start thinking about Cost and efficiency: consider the price of childcare and how it meets to your budget, plus the capability of the place and hours of procedure. Compare prices, charges, and repayment choices among various providers to find the best value for your family. Consider factors eg transport, distance to your home or work, and freedom in scheduling.
